In case of a blinking indicator lamp
;,
pressure on the fuel tank system needs to be
released first.
A malfunction in the system has been
detected if
R the indicator lamp ; fails to stop blinking
after approximately 10 seconds after the
fuel filler flap switch : has been pressed
R the indicator lamp ; does not come on at
all
R the malfunction indicator lamp ! (USA
only) or ; (Canada only) comes on
The fuel filler flap is located on the right-hand
side of the vehicle towards the rear.
i In case the fuel filler flap switch does not
release the fuel filler flap, see “Opening the
fuel filler flap manually” ( Y page 31).G
Warning!
Remove fuel filler cap slowly. Fuel spray may
cause injury.
Complete refueling within 20 minutes after
opening the fuel filler flap. Otherwise fuel may
spray out and cause injury. If the refueling
process cannot be completed within
20 minutes, press the fuel filler flap switch
again.
i Leaving the combustion engine running
and the fuel filler cap open can cause the
yellow fuel tank reserve warning lamp to
flash and the malfunction indicator
lamp ! (USA only) or ; (Canada
only) to illuminate.
For more information on refueling, see
Operator's Manual. X
Opening: Pull fuel filler flap = out in
direction of arrow.
X Turn fuel filler cap ? counterclockwise.
X Take off fuel filler cap ?.
! The fuel filler cap is tethered to the fuel
filler neck. Do not drop the cap. It could
damage the vehicle paint finish.
X Set fuel filler cap ? on fuel filler flap =.
X Fully insert filler nozzle unit and refuel.
X Only fill your tank until the filler nozzle unit
cuts out – do not top off or overfill .
X Closing: Turn fuel filler cap ? until it
audibly engages.
X Close fuel filler flap =.
The fuel filler flap is locked.

The amount of oil your combustion engine
consumes will depend on a number of factors,
including driving style. Increased oil
consumption can occur when the vehicle is
new or the vehicle is driven frequently at
higher engine speeds.
Engine oil consumption checks should only
be made after the vehicle break-in period.
! Do not use any special lubricant additives,
as these may damage the drive assemblies. Operation

Notes on checking engine oil level
When checking the oil level the vehicle must
be parked on level ground and the vehicle
must have been stationary for at least
5 minutes with the combustion engine turned
off. Checking engine oil level
Before opening the hood do the following:
X Engage the parking brake.
X Shift the automatic transmission into park
position P.
X Switch off the ignition.
The READY indicator (Y page 16) in the
instrument cluster goes out.
X Remove the SmartKey from the starter
switch or remove the SmartKey with
KEYLESS-GO from the vehicle.
X Observe the safety notes on the danger of
electric shock in this manual.
X Open the hood, see Operator's Manual. X
Remove cover : by pulling it in direction
of arrow. X
Pull out oil dipstick ;.
X Wipe oil dipstick ; clean.
X Fully insert oil dipstick ; into the dipstick
guide tube.
X Pull out oil dipstick ; again after
approximately 3 seconds to obtain
accurate reading.
The oil level is correct when it is between
lower (min) mark ? and upper (max) mark
= of oil dipstick ;.
i The filling quantity between the upper and
lower marks on the oil dipstick is
approximately 2.1 US qt. (2.0 l).
X If necessary, add engine oil ( Y page 22).
X Install cover :.
